For the record, here is the summary published by Google:
http://www.google.com/appsstatus/ir/4et50yp2ckm8otv.pdf

Probably already seen by most people on this list. The relevant piece
is:
> A configuration change during this migration shifted the formatting
> behavior of a service option so that it incorrectly provided an
> invalid domain name, instead of the intended "gmail.com" domain name,
> to the Google SMTP inbound service. As a result, the service
> incorrectly transformed lookups of certain email addresses ending in
> "@gmail.com" into non-existent email addresses. When the Gmail user
> accounts service checked each of these non-existent email addresses,
> the service could not detect a valid user, resulting in SMTP error
> code 550.
